§ 4-30-18-4 — Indiana or local law restricting or prohibiting possession, manufacture, transportation, distribution, advertising, or sale of lottery ticket; application
An Indiana or local law providing a penalty for
or disability, restriction, or prohibition against the possession,
manufacture, transportation, distribution, advertising, or sale of a
lottery ticket does not apply to the sale of lottery tickets under this
article nor to the possession of a ticket issued by any other government
operated lottery.
